[RFC] ARM/mem: handle data aborts gracefully for md

Jan Luebbe jlu at pengutronix.de
Sun Aug 3 08:51:38 PDT 2014


Sometimes memory ranges contain inaccessible registers which trigger a
data abort when accessed. To handle this gracefully, we extend the data
abort exception handler to ignore the exception when configured to do
so.

This allows detecting inaccessible memory from the md command. It will
show XX for unreadable bytes instead.

The current implementation breaks everything except ARM and takes several
shortcuts which need to be implemented more cleanly. Suggestions are very
welcome!

+	.macro try_data_abort
+	ldr	r13, =abort_conf		@ check try mode
+	ldr	r13, [r13]
+	cmp	r13, #0
+	bne	no_abort_\@
+	ldr	r13, =abort_conf		@ disable try mode
+	str	r13, [r13]
+	mrs	r13, spsr			@ read saved CPSR
+	tst	r13, #1<<5			@ check Thumb mode
+	subeq	lr, #4				@ next ARM instr
+	subne	lr, #6				@ next Thumb instr
+	movs	pc, lr
+no_abort_\@:
+	.endm
